Brown: Ferrari and Liberty confrontation is inevitable

Ferrari big boss Sergio Marchionne has made it clear where he stands regarding the future of Formula 1, his views seen as a taunt to the sport's American owners Liberty Media as knives are sharpened for the battle to carve the way forward for the sport. Marchionne has referred to F1 motorsport chief Ross Brawn as Moses dishing out the commandments and warning Liberty Media not to deviate from the ethos of what Formula 1 is and should be going forward. Needless to say, their respective road-maps appear to differ and animosity between the parties is mounting.
